Getting to Know Your Generator: Types and Functions
Generators act as vital sources of power across various scenarios, spanning residential use to industrial applications. They are generally classified into portable and standby categories. Portable generators tend to be smaller units built for temporary use, making them a great choice for camping, tailgating, or serving as emergency backup during outages. These generators provide convenience and flexibility, giving users the ability to move them effortlessly as the situation demands.
Standby generators, by comparison, are fixed installations that automatically engage whenever a power failure occurs. They are typically integrated into the home's electrical system, offering a smooth transition to backup power. Within these categories, generators can run on different fuel sources, including gasoline, diesel, propane, or natural gas, each having its own advantages and disadvantages.

Spotting Frequent Generator Faults
Diagnosing generator issues promptly can prevent further complications and secure reliable performance. Common generator problems often manifest as unusual noises, failure to start, or inconsistent power output. A generator experiencing starting difficulties might suggest a Generac Generator Repair depleted battery, fuel complications, or a malfunctioning ignition system. Unusual sounds, such as grinding or rattling, could suggest mechanical wear or loose components, demanding immediate inspection.
Power fluctuations frequently indicate issues related to the electrical regulator or other electrical components, affecting overall efficiency. Furthermore, generators can produce smoke or strong odors, pointing to fuel seepage or excessive heat, which require urgent attention. Regularly checking oil conditions, fuel supplies, and air filtration can help detect these issues early. Frequent Oil Changes
One of the most essential aspects of generator maintenance is the practice of regular oil changes. This procedure guarantees that the engine runs smoothly and efficiently by limiting friction and protecting against wear. Over time, oil may accumulate debris, metallic particles, and combustion residue, causing diminished performance and potential harm. It is generally recommended to change the oil after every 100 hours of operation or at least once a year, depending on which milestone is reached first. Using the correct type and grade of oil, as recommended by the manufacturer, is vital for maximum performance. Overlooking this maintenance requirement can cause overheating, elevated fuel usage, and ultimately, generator breakdown. Routine oil changes play a key role in prolonging the generator's lifespan.
Pure Air Filters
Maintaining clean air filters is crucial to maximize a generator's efficiency and lifespan. Air filters prevent dust and debris from entering the engine, which may result in inefficient combustion and costly damage. Routine inspection and cleaning of air filters are essential, especially in environments with high dust levels. It is advisable to examine filters every few months and change them out if they exhibit signs of deterioration or significant debris buildup. A well-maintained air filter enhances airflow, boosting fuel efficiency and minimizing engine stress. This straightforward upkeep task can significantly prolong the generator's lifespan, ensuring it operates smoothly when needed. Systematic Troubleshooting Techniques
Diagnosing generator issues demands a methodical approach to pinpoint and address issues successfully. Start the process by checking the primary power components. If the generator does not start, confirm the fuel tank is full and the fuel is uncontaminated. Next, inspect the oil levels; low oil can trigger automatic shutdowns. Moving forward, examine the battery connections for corrosion or looseness. If the generator operates but generates no electricity, checking the circuit breaker and fuses is essential.
Moreover, inspect the spark plug for signs of wear or damage, as a defective spark plug can interfere with the ignition process. If the unit produces abnormal sounds, this may point to underlying problems that require further examination. As a final step, referencing the instruction manual for specific troubleshooting guidance can offer customized solutions. Follow Safety Precautions for Generator Repairs
When performing generator repairs, following safety precautions is essential to avoid accidents and injuries. To begin, ensure that the generator is powered down and separated from any electrical source. This reduces the chances of electric shock. Using personal protective equipment, like gloves and protective eyewear, can help protect against potential dangers. Working in a well-ventilated area is strongly encouraged to minimize exposure to harmful fumes from fuel or exhaust.
Moreover, having a fire extinguisher within reach is essential, as generators can pose fire hazards. Repair professionals should also be careful when working with fuel, making sure that any spills are addressed immediately to minimize the risk of slips and fires. Lastly, having a first aid kit accessible can be beneficial in case of minor accidents. When Is It Time to Call a Professional for Generator Repairs?
Generator fixes can often be tackled by experienced individuals, but some circumstances require the skills of a trained professional. Should a generator refuse to start after initial troubleshooting attempts, it may indicate deeper issues that require specialized knowledge. Furthermore, ongoing strange sounds or vibrations may indicate mechanical issues that could deteriorate without professional attention.
Electrical malfunctions, such as tripped circuit breakers or burnt wires, pose serious safety risks and require attention from a licensed electrician. If the generator is leaking fuel or oil, urgent professional intervention is required to avoid possible fire risks. Additionally, if the generator is still under warranty, performing self-repairs could invalidate the warranty, making professional service a prudent choice. Preparing Your Generator for Seasonal Changes
As the seasons shift, getting a generator ready for varying weather conditions is critical to ensure optimal performance. Routine maintenance ought to be planned ahead of seasonal transitions, emphasizing tasks relevant to the coming climate. In preparation for winter, confirming proper fuel stabilization and battery health is critical, because frigid temperatures can influence performance. Moreover, examining the oil levels and swapping filters assists in reducing complications during demanding usage.
By comparison, summer readiness involves inspecting cooling systems, as elevated temperatures can lead to overheating. Maintaining air filters and checking ventilation pathways are critical for proper airflow.
On a regular basis throughout the year, it's important to conduct regular load tests on the generator to confirm proper operation. This practice not only detects possible issues but also assures reliability when needed. Additionally, shielding the generator from severe environmental factors, such as rain or snow, by using appropriate covers or housing can greatly extend its lifespan and sustain peak operating efficiency.

How Regularly Should I Run My Generator for Maintenance?
Generators need to be started at least once a month as part of routine maintenance. Consistent operation assists in maintain fuel quality, lubricates internal components, and identifies potential issues, guaranteeing dependable performance when required, ultimately lengthening the lifespan of the generator.
Can My Generator Be Used Indoors?
Indoor use of generators should always be avoided as a result of the serious carbon monoxide poisoning hazard. Adequate ventilation is absolutely necessary, so they must be operated outdoors in well-ventilated areas to ensure safety and avoid the buildup of dangerous gases.
What Is the Best Fuel for My Generator?
The best fuel for a generator commonly involves diesel or unleaded gasoline, according to the generator type. Choosing the right fuel guarantees optimal performance, efficiency, and a longer lifespan, as well as taking into account environmental and storage considerations.
How Do I Store My Generator Safely?
To store a generator safely, make sure it's free of dirt and moisture, drain the fuel to avoid degradation, protect it with a covering tarp, and place it in a ventilated, dry location clear of flammable materials.
